Transaction d333fa063f0762138d6718d346a3b92ec201ccb8a1e5480863e85c30e26286ec
1 Input
1 Output
-
d333fa063f0762138d6718d346a3b92ec201ccb8a1e5480863e85c30e26286ec:0
- value
- 1365741
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c87939e0311c3e56de740b1a4b4ad0786d885880 OP_EQUAL
- address
- 3Ky2HqyyzNZL1QoFqiv8GvVwo5D8FD7toh